This was just an exercise I did to compact the pseudocode in XRI 
Resolution 2.0 WD11-ED06, section 12.6.
By assuming the semantics of looping constructs in "modern procedural 
languages", I was able to save 13 lines.

The new pseudocode is attached, and I'm listing the diff here:


--- sel.old     2007-10-22 22:15:15.000000000 +0000
+++ sel.new     2007-10-22 22:34:30.000000000 +0000
@@ -9,19 +9,11 @@
                                NEXT SEP
                        ELSE
                                SET Positive.x=TRUE
-                               NEXT SEL
                        ENDIF
                ELSEIF match on this SEL is DEFAULT     ;see 10.3.2 & 12.3.4
-                       IF Positive.x=TRUE                      ;see 12.3.5
-                               NEXT SEL
-                       ELSEIF nodefault="x"            ;see 10.3.2
-                               NEXT SEL
-                       ELSE
+                       IF Positive.x != TRUE AND nodefault != x        
;see 12.3.5
                                SET Default.x=TRUE
-                               NEXT SEL
                        ENDIF
-               ELSEIF match on this SEL is NEGATIVE    ;see 12.3.1
-                       NEXT SEL
                ENDIF
        ENDFOR
        IF Matched.x=FALSE                                      ;see 12.3.3
@@ -42,10 +34,7 @@
                ADD SEP TO DEFAULT SET                  ;see 12.4.4
        ENDIF
 ENDFOR
-IF SELECTED SET != EMPTY                               ;see 12.5.1
-       RETURN SELECTED SET
-ENDIF
-IF DEFAULT SET != EMPTY                                ;see 12.5.2
+IF SELECTED SET = EMPTY                                ;see 12.5.1
        FOR EACH SEP IN DEFAULT SET
                IF (Positive.Type=TRUE AND Positive.Path=TRUE) OR
                (Positive.Type=TRUE AND Positive.MediaType=TRUE) OR
@@ -53,20 +42,18 @@
                        ADD SEP TO SELECTED SET
                ENDIF
        ENDFOR
-       IF SELECTED SET != EMPTY
-               RETURN SELECTED SET
-       ENDIF
-       FOR EACH SEP IN DEFAULT SET
-               IF Positive.Type=TRUE OR
-               Positive.Path=TRUE OR
-               Positive.MediaType=TRUE
-                       ADD SEP TO SELECTED SET
-               ENDIF
-       ENDFOR
-       IF SELECTED SET != EMPTY
-               RETURN SELECTED SET
-       ELSE
-               RETURN DEFAULT SET
+       IF SELECTED SET = EMPTY
+               FOR EACH SEP IN DEFAULT SET
+                       IF Positive.Type=TRUE OR
+                       Positive.Path=TRUE OR
+                       Positive.MediaType=TRUE
+                               ADD SEP TO SELECTED SET
+                       ENDIF
+               ENDFOR
        ENDIF
 ENDIF
-RETURN EMPTY SET
+IF SELECTED SET != EMPTY
+       RETURN SELECTED SET
+ELSE
+       RETURN DEFAULT SET
+ENDIF
